Srpski језикThis 4-Way Irrigation Valve Manifold with 2 Valves are designed for low-pressure agricultural irrigation systems. It adopts a practical 4-port structure consisting of 1 upper inlet, 1 straight-through main outlet, and 2 side outlets with independent control valves. This structure allows individual branch isolation without interrupting mainline water flow, supporting flexible zone-based irrigation and in-line maintenance. It is widely used in orchards, greenhouses, and municipal landscaping projects requiring partitioned water control.
These 4-Way Irrigation Valve Manifold with 2 Valves are available in standard equal-diameter and reducing sizes to match mainstream agricultural soft hoses, drip tapes, and micro-spray tubes. All ports feature standard barbed connections for stable assembly with conventional hose clamps.

Each component is manufactured with industrial-grade materials selected for long-term outdoor irrigation stability and reliable repeated operation.
Manifold Body:
Thickened UV-stabilized PP material with one-piece injection molding. Resists outdoor aging and UV degradation, maintaining stable structural performance under regular field irrigation conditions.
Valve Core:
Precision POM material delivers excellent dimensional stability and wear resistance. It minimizes sediment-related jamming and ensures smooth repeated opening and closing in normal irrigation water.
Sealing Rings:
EPDM/NBR composite rubber provides consistent sealing performance under low-pressure water circulation and daily ambient temperature changes.
Operating Handle:
Galvanized metal construction offers durable manual operation and reliable deformation resistance for long-term field use.
The dual-valve independent structure supports three practical operating modes while allowing the mainline to remain open when branch isolation is required.
Both Valves Closed: Mainline flow continues through the straight-through outlet while both side branches are fully isolated for maintenance or zoning adjustment.
Single Valve Open: One independent branch operates separately while the other branch remains isolated, supporting targeted zone irrigation and partial line inspection.
Both Valves Open: Dual side branches work simultaneously to deliver synchronous multi-area irrigation.
Continuous Mainline Operation:
Individual branch valves can isolate a single branch for inspection, flushing or routine maintenance while the straight-through mainline remains in service. It avoids full-system shutdown and supports stable irrigation during crop growing seasons.

Installation Steps
1.Select a matching manifold size according to on-site hose specifications.
2.Insert the hose fully into the barbed port until completely seated.
3.Secure the joint with stainless steel clamps. Tighten firmly following the clamp manufacturer’s recommended torque standard.
4.Operate the valves smoothly for trial operation and inspect all connections for tightness and leakage.
Maintenance Guidelines
1.Flush internal sediment regularly during each planting season to maintain stable water flow.
2.Inspect sealing ring conditions before each irrigation season and replace worn, hardened or leaking components in a timely manner.
3.Drain residual water from the manifold system during low-temperature seasons to prevent freeze-related structural damage.
